the former Renault factory will be used for a new brand – La Nouvelle Tribune

The former factory of the French car manufacturer Renault was officially renamed to Moskvitch, according to the State Register of Legal Entities. The changes were registered on June 3. Previously, the mayor of Moscow, Sergei Sobyaninhad said that the Renault Russia plant, now owned by Moscow, would produce cars under the Moskvitch brand, and that Kamaz would become the main technological partner of the revived Moscow plant.

It is planned to initially launch the production of cars with internal combustion engines and in the future electric cars. The Ministry of Industry and Trade of the Russian Federation plans to start production of cars under the Moskvitch brand at the former Renault Russia plant this year. Dmitry Pronin, deputy director of the Moscow Department of Transport and Road Infrastructure Development, was appointed director of the automobile plant. (Tasse)
